In November 2004, back in New York to visit his family, Walid Raad was detained and questioned by the police and the FBI for several hours at Rochester airport. Before his amazed eyes pass all the things in his suitcase; photographs, videotapes, documents and books, bank statements, you name it. In this unique framework and from the angle of the interrogation, all these innocent objects take on a wholly different meaning. An allegory of the frail identity and security of the western nations in the wake of September 11, I Feel A Great Desire To Meet The Masses Once Again is above all a softened picture of a much more chilling reality, that of the policy of extraordinary rendition, the so-called legal kidnappings carried out by the CIA as a matter of course since the 1990s. |
